1. At first, you have to ask your client (i.e. user) to complete the following steps:
* after the user received the device, he has to insert the SIM card in the first (primary) SIM card slot The PIN code requirement must be disabled on the SIM card beforehand, as well as call, SMS and GPRS data options must be activated (if a prepaid type SIM card is used)).
* Next, the user has to power up the alarm system by plugging the main power supply.
* Finally, the user has to inform you that the device is ready to be configured.
2. Establishing a connection with the device via phone call:
NOTE: Please contact your SIM card mobile operator to ensure if you need to enter APN settings (Name, User, Password).
Quick guide No. 1 (when no APN settings required):
Make sure Pitbull Alarm PRO has been powered up and has an active SIM card
1. Dial the phone number of the SIM card inserted in the device;
2. Shortly, the system will send you a text message with an SMS code, confirming your admin rights;
3. Send an SMS command “stconfig” from the same personal mobile phone. This command will help to initiate the remote connection:
XXXX stconfig
(Enter the previously received SMS code in place of “XXXX“);
4. Using Utility software, connect to Pitbull Alarm Pro remotely by entering the received IMEI number (previously received in SMS).
5. After successful connection, you can continue the device configuration process remotely.
6. It is recommended to remotely configure the alarm system with the Service Mode enabled. This mode will ensure that there will be no interruptions during the configuration process.
Quick guide No. 2 (when you must enter APN settings):
Make sure Pitbull Alarm PRO has been powered up and has an active SIM card
1. Dial the phone number of the SIM card inserted in the device;
2. Shortly, the system will send you a text message with an SMS code, confirming your admin rights;
3. Set mobile operator’s Access Point Name (APN), by sending the SMS command:
XXXX SETGPRS:APN:internet
(Enter the previously received SMS code in place of “XXXX“);
Similarly, enter the previously received APN (provided by the GSM operator) in place of “internet”.
4. Set the User name of GPRS parameters (provided by the GSM operator), by sending the SMS command:
XXXX SETGPRS:USER:USR
(Enter the previously received SMS code in place of “XXXX“);
Similarly, enter the previously received User name (provided by the GSM operator) in place of “USR”.
5. Set the Password of GPRS parameters (provided by the GSM operator), by sending the SMS command:
XXXX SETGPRS:PSW:PASS
(Enter the previously received SMS code in place of “XXXX“);
Similarly, enter the previously received Password (provided by the GSM operator) in place of “PASS”.
6. Send an SMS command “stconfig” from the same personal mobile phone. This command will help to initiate the remote connection:
XXXX stconfig
Enter the previously received SMS code in place of “XXXX”.
7. Using Utility software, connect to Pitbull Alarm Pro remotely by entering the received IMEI number (previously received in SMS).
8. After successful connection you can continue the device configuration process remotely.
9. It is recommended to remotely configure the alarm system with the Service Mode enabled. This mode will ensure that there will be no interruptions during the configuration process.
